    Always on the quest to try different bakeries & sweets, I came across Babka Bailout via an Instagram Giveaway several months ago. When I googled their address, I was surprised to see how close they are to my apartment in Hoboken. Their shop is located in the heights and they ship nationwide. I corresponded with the shop directly since I needed to understand the shipping timeframes given I needed the babkas for a party a few days later. The owner was very helpful and I was able to place my order Friday and have it ubered to my apartment in Hoboken on Monday. I ordered 4 different flavors. Sadly, on the day of delivery, they let me know they were all out of the cereal flavor (even though I had advance ordered) and she swapped it for Nutella oreo instead, and even threw in 2 extra babkas at no charge! That was very generous of them to do, especially during the busy holiday season. From the flavors I tried, I really enjoyed the Nutella Oreo, the Ube Nutella Oreo, and the chocolate ganache covered Nutella. The savory zhater feta mozzarella was a big hit amongst the crowd. The Dulce de Leche was the most mild flavor of the ones I tried. I haven't dug into the truffle burrata one yet but I imagine it will be delightful! I like that this shop has unique flavors - much different than the flavors you see at Breads Bakery which is more traditional. I would definitely order from here again - afterall I still have to try the cereal milk flavor.

    Great local bakery in The Heights section of Jersey City specializing in babkas. They have a walk-up window for retail customers and also fill wholesale orders. We had both an apple and a Nutella babka, both were excellent. There are also other baked items, like hamantaschen, available as well. the staff is lovely and the price is right for such quality.
